2019 - My GF and I each own our own home, We each have a homestead exemption for our respective property

Nov 2020 - We mutually buy a house together however we are not engaged or married. Girlfriend files homestead exemption on our new house and removes it from her house. I dont do anything on my home (truly didn't realize i had to)

Get married in Q2 2022

June 2022 - Audit company says we have 2 homestead exemptions (main house, and my house) Wants me to get with HCAD and remove homestead from 2021 and 2022.

Lesson learned : Applying for homestead for new home does not automatically remove your current homestead exemptions.

Since we were not married at the time of buying this home, am I not eligible for homestead on my own home as long as one of us took it off our individual home to put towards our main home?
